What’s important for Shopify sellers to know about Online Store 2.0?

Shopify Online Store 2.0 empowers owners with unparalleled control and flexibility to customize their store to their liking, resulting in increased chances of success. We have curated a list of the most potent features and their corresponding benefits that this upgrade provides.

One of the most significant upgrades is the ability to add, remove, and rearrange sections on every page of your store, not just the homepage. This feature enables you to add any element you desire to your page, such as a banner or text section, and rearrange them as per your preference. Furthermore, you can now create custom product, collection, blog, and page templates effortlessly without the need for a developer, thanks to this new feature.

Shopify has also introduced its built-in metafield feature, allowing you to add extra data to various parts of your store, including pages, customers, and orders. Previously, you could only add a title or a single rich editor. Still, you can now add details such as ingredient lists or size charts within Shopify without needing APIs or external applications. You can even include different file types using Shopify’s file picker.

In addition, Shopify has improved its Theme Editor with a new “tree-down” view, which makes visualizing your sections easier. You can now add liquid code directly from the theme editor, streamlining the process of customizing your store.

Lastly, checkout customization is now available to non-Plus members through checkout apps. You can now add custom fields, banners, and other unique touches to the checkout experience to make it more seamless. However, full customization is still exclusive to Plus members.

Can I Consider Dawn Shopify Theme?

Dawn could be worth your consideration – it is an entirely free theme that is an excellent choice for many users. In fact, it is 35% faster than the popular Debut theme, has all the remarkable features of Shopify 2.0, and operates effortlessly on all browsers and devices.
